Abstract

The utility model provides a dedusting flue which is used for processing smoke exhausted by a boiler and the like and collecting harmful matter in the smoke before the smoke is exhausted into air to prevent the harmful matter from polluting the air. The dedusting flue comprises a flue body which comprises a dedusting section which is in the shape of a Chinese character 'ji' and formed by connecting horizontal pipelines and vertical pipelines. Water spray nozzles are arranged in the dedusting section, and drain pipes are arranged at the bottom of the dedusting section. In the flowing process of the smoke along the dedusting section, the water spray nozzles spray water towards the smoke, water can adsorb dust in the smoke and can dissolve NO, NO2 and sulfur compound in the smoke, and dust and harmful matter are prevented from being exhausted to the air. Water with dissolved harmful matter is drained through the drain pipes and can be further processed, and details of the further processing step are omitted here. The dedusting section in the shape of the Chinese character 'ji' can increase collision probability of the smoke and the wall of the flue so that the probability that the smoke is adsorbed on the wall of the flue can be increased, and the smoke adsorbed on the wall of the flue is finally drained along with water flow to be further processed.
